Either way, you're right. On top of that when the domain is expiring they send you almost daily notices. Even the crappy registrars. It's very hard to "let a domain expire" without being aware of it expiring.

You can transfer a domain between registrars as long as you have it unlocked at the current registrar and you provide a transfer code to the new registrar (usual method although different registrars may handle that differently).  Sounds to me like they did something to the current registrar which allowed it to be transferred.  Whether that means they hacked them or social engineered it or what I don't know.  As soon as it is transferred it would show a new registration date at the new registrar.

As far as using the MX record to intercept email that still requires a mail server at the destination IP which takes some effort.  Once they had re-registered the domain, changing the MX record would be trivial though.  Right now I show the mx record pointed at 54.204.22.76 which appears to be one of many mail server IP's for a place called mail.b-io.co.  I don't know anything about that place so I don't know if you could just setup an account and start receiving email there for a domain you "owned".
